Cluster alternatives
Users often look for Cluster alternatives due to persistent issues with photo uploads, slow loading times, and a lack of updates, which lead to glitches and crashes. Alternatives offer more reliable photo sharing, better organization features, or different functionalities entirely, depending on user needs.
Why users look for alternatives to Cluster
- Users experience frequent issues with photos not uploading, loading slowly, or failing to upload entirely.R1R4R7R10
- The app is prone to glitches, freezing, and crashing, making it unreliable for many users.R7R15R16R24
- Many users report that the app is outdated, lacks meaningful updates, and has a poor user interface.R19R24R49
- There are ongoing problems with notifications not working and login issues.R9R15R21R30
- Some Android users face compatibility issues, with the app stating it's made for older versions of Android.R6R15R49
- The app lacks features like categories, folders, search functionality, or QR codes for groups, making it difficult to organize and share photos efficiently for some users.R3R11R22
